mirror of
				https://github.com/yiisoft/yii2.git
				synced 2025-10-31 18:47:33 +08:00 
			
		
		
		
	
		
			
				
	
	
		
			24 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			PHP
		
	
	
	
	
	
			
		
		
	
	
			24 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			PHP
		
	
	
	
	
	
| <?php
 | |
| /* @var $exception \yii\base\Exception */
 | |
| /* @var $handler \yii\web\ErrorHandler */
 | |
| ?>
 | |
| <div class="previous">
 | |
|     <span class="arrow">↵</span>
 | |
|     <h2>
 | |
|         <span>Caused by:</span>
 | |
|         <?php $name = $handler->getExceptionName($exception) ?>
 | |
|         <?php if ($name !== null): ?>
 | |
|             <span><?= $handler->htmlEncode($name) ?></span> –
 | |
|             <?= $handler->addTypeLinks(get_class($exception)) ?>
 | |
|         <?php else: ?>
 | |
|             <span><?= $handler->htmlEncode(get_class($exception)) ?></span>
 | |
|         <?php endif; ?>
 | |
|     </h2>
 | |
|     <h3><?= nl2br($handler->htmlEncode($exception->getMessage())) ?></h3>
 | |
|     <p>in <span class="file"><?= $exception->getFile() ?></span> at line <span class="line"><?= $exception->getLine() ?></span></p>
 | |
|     <?php if ($exception instanceof \yii\db\Exception && !empty($exception->errorInfo)): ?>
 | |
|         <pre>Error Info: <?= $handler->htmlEncode(print_r($exception->errorInfo, true)) ?></pre>
 | |
|     <?php endif ?>
 | |
|     <?= $handler->renderPreviousExceptions($exception) ?>
 | |
| </div>
 | 
